Find All Needingworth Hotels
We have found 1260 Needingworth Hotels
- University of Cambridge, Homerton College - Campus Accommodation
- Thorn House
- University of Cambridge, Westminster Cottages - Campus Accommodation
- The Lion Hotel Buckden
- Arbury Manor
- Castle Hill Resident
- Populus House
- University of Cambridge, West Court - Campus Accommodation
- Entire 2 Bedroom Flat Next to Kings College
- University of Cambridge, Christ's College - Hostel
- Central Cambridge Contemporary Penthouse
- The Cambridge Suites -Tas Accommodations
- Exquisite Modern Cambridge Townhouse
- Hippodrome By JD Wetherspoon
- Days Inn by Wyndham Sandy
- rose marie guesthouse
- Orchard Cottage
- White House lodge
- Premier Inn Peterborough City Centre